JavaScript不能直接将日期格式化为工作日后跟日期,但可以使用一些方法来实现这个功能。
一种方法是使用JavaScript的Date对象和相关方法来计算日期。以下是一个示例代码:
function formatDate(date) {
const weekdays = ['Sunday', 'Monday', 'Tuesday', 'Wednesday', 'Thursday', 'Friday', 'Saturday'];
const day = date.getDay(); // 获取星期几,0表示星期日,1表示星期一,以此类推
const formattedDate = `${weekdays[day]} ${date.toLocaleDateString()}`;
return formattedDate;
}
const today = new Date();
const formattedDate = formatDate(today);
console.log(formattedDate);
这段代码中,我们首先定义了一个包含星期几名称的数组。然后,使用getDay()
方法获取给定日期的星期几,并使用toLocaleDateString()
方法将日期格式化为字符串。最后,将星期几和日期拼接起来,得到最终的格式化日期。
这个方法可以用于将任意日期格式化为工作日后跟日期。例如,如果今天是星期三,那么格式化后的日期可能是"Wednesday 10/20/2021"。
在腾讯云的产品中,与日期相关的服务包括云函数(SCF)和云数据库(CDB)。云函数可以用于执行自定义的JavaScript代码,而云数据库可以用于存储和查询日期数据。你可以根据具体需求选择适合的产品。
腾讯云云函数(SCF)产品介绍:https://cloud.tencent.com/product/scf
腾讯云云数据库(CDB)产品介绍:https://cloud.tencent.com/product/cdb
没有搜到相关的沙龙
领取专属 10元无门槛券
手把手带您无忧上云